你查询的IP:[119.128.95.180]  地理位置:中国–广东–东莞

最新查询202.95.111.182 221.14.132.209 121.147.16.144 123.96.107.211 119.253.134.93 122.48.195.214 219.216.28.233 121.56.195.164 221.208.124.36 119.128.95.180 221.199.212.169 116.8.125.41 203.191.144.22 121.204.168.40 220.242.83.242 203.132.32.89 210.25.248.175 116.207.121.105 61.48.180.94 220.192.153.74 202.93.252.166 121.58.11.165 211.160.120.250 117.122.128.27 210.56.192.217 203.18.50.218 211.96.248.28 192.124.154.70 202.4.128.86 116.194.70.204 58.192.3.67